Skip to content

Commit 47653ae

Browse files
committed
Fix Shopsys
1 parent 57cf08d commit 47653ae

File tree

4 files changed

+29
-3
lines changed

4 files changed

+29
-3
lines changed

.github/workflows/integration-tests.yml

Lines changed: 12 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-328,16 +328,25 @@ jobs:
328328
cp ../sylius-composer.lock composer.lock
329329
composer install
330330
phpstan-command: ../../../phpstan.phar analyse -c ../sylius.neon
331+
baseline-file: sylius-baseline.neon
331332
- php-version: 8.3
332333
repo: shopsys/shopsys
333334
ref: v14.0.0
334335
setup: |
335-
export DATABASE_URL=sqlite:///%kernel.project_dir%/var/data.db
336336
composer install
337337
338338
# from build.xml
339-
phpstan-command: ../../../phpstan.phar analyse -c ../shopsys.neon -l 5 packages/*/src packages/*/tests project-base/app project-base/app/src project-base/app/tests utils/*/src utils/*/tests
340-
baseline-file: sylius-baseline.neon
339+
phpstan-command: ../../../phpstan.phar analyse -c ../shopsys.neon -l 5 packages/*/src packages/*/tests utils/*/src utils/*/tests
340+
- php-version: 8.3
341+
repo: shopsys/shopsys
342+
ref: v14.0.0
343+
setup: |
344+
cd project-base/app
345+
composer install
346+
347+
# test project-base separately
348+
phpstan-command: ../../../../../phpstan.phar analyse -c ../../../shopsys-project-base.neon -l 5 src tests
349+
baseline-file: shopsys-project-base-baseline.neon
341350
- php-version: 8.1
342351
repo: doctrine/orm
343352
ref: 2.13.1
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,6 @@
1+
parameters:
2+
ignoreErrors:
3+
-
4+
message: "#^Call to an undefined method Tests\\\\App\\\\Test\\\\Codeception\\\\AcceptanceTester\\:\\:selectOptionInSelect2ByCssAndValue\\(\\)\\.$#"
5+
count: 1
6+
path: repo/project-base/app/tests/App/Acceptance/acceptance/PageObject/Admin/ProductAdvancedSearchPage.php
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
includes:
2+
- repo/project-base/app/phpstan.neon
3+
- shopsys-project-base-baseline.neon
4+
5+
parameters:
6+
reportUnmatchedIgnoredErrors: false
7+
excludePaths:
8+
- repo/project-base/app/tests/App/Test/Codeception/AcceptanceTester.php

e2e/integration/shopsys.neon

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,6 @@
11
includes:
22
- repo/phpstan.neon
33
- shopsys-baseline.neon
4+
5+
parameters:
6+
reportUnmatchedIgnoredErrors: false

0 commit comments

Comments
 (0)